“Aama” (mother) was of course the first Nepali Film produced in Nepal in 2021 B.E. It was produced by the Information Department of Government of Nepal. Shiva Shankar Manandhar (renowned radio singer and music composer) and Bhuvan Thapa (Theatre Artist) made their debut as the lead players in the movie. The film had Hira Singh Khatri as its director and V. Balsara was the music composer.

Presently ,most of the people choose QFX cinema or Big Cinema .QFX cinemas has 3 branches at different places. Jay Nepal , Kumari Hall and QFX central are now consider as QFX cinemas. Jay Nepal is located at almost 5-10 min walk from Kings way , while Kumari Cinema is at Kamal Pokhari and QFX Central is located at Civil Mall complex located at Sundhara. Whereas Big cinemas is at City Centre ,kamal Pokhari.Both Big Cinemas and QFX central has multi screen so you don’t need to worry about waiting 3 hours for each show. Hardly you need to wait 30 min as each screen movie are showing continuously.

QFX Cinemas started with the renovation of Jai Nepal Cinema, which is the oldest cinema house in Nepal. Following the development, Jai Nepal and company revamped and launched Kumari hall. QFX Civil Mall in Sundhara is Nepal’s first most advanced multiplex. After successfully operating its chain in Kathmandu Valley, QFX Cinemas opened franchise model: Bageshwori theater in Nepalgunj, Jalma theater in Narayanghat, Chitwan, Cineplex theater in Pokhara. As of January 2017, the company had 15 screens in Nepal.
